Here's Ulden in between the fjords and mountains of Norway.

Your challenge is to:

1. Brighten the land: The meadows, mountains, and trees contain many shades of green. The rocks are not gray or green!

2. The houses are of many colors, they need to need bright and colorful.

3. Noise is a problem on the buildings close to the water. It may appear as color noise on your screen. Eliminate all noise in your image.

4. Replace the sky. The present sky is not good on the left. You could change it to gray but that is not acceptable. Replacing the sky is a requirement.

5. Sharpen as required. Zoom to 100% to check your work.

Work images .jpg or RAW as preferred.

Context: To sell Norway as a travel destination.

Revet that is close, but you forgot to remove all the noise. (Click on your download and click again on the new image.) The noise is most obvious on the buildings next to the boats and water. Load your image into your photo editor. Zoom into the buildings. Find the Denoise Filter and move the slider all the way up. Your image will go very soft. Pull the slider back until the noise just begins to appear. Now adjust the numbers until the noise disappears. Go to your Clarity filter (if you have one.) and add clarity by the default numbers. Now Sharpen to make the image pin sharp.
You'll realise the image should have been a tad brighter. A good effort, you get four thumbs:
